Description

A diabetic patient with iron deficiency may develop problems in glucose control.


Patient selection: diabetic patient who is iron deficient

 

Manifestations of poor glucose control in a patient who is iron deficient:

(1) increase in hemoglobin A1c levels despite optimum management

(2) increase in insulin needs and/or poorly controlled glucose

 

If these are due to iron deficiency, then they should improve when the patient is iron replete.

 

The changes may be most noticeable in a previously well-controlled diabetic who becomes iron deficient.
